Vladimir
А мне нужно чтобы зависимости брались из локального репозитория, то есть из папки
Vladimir
Короче мне нужно папку тупо скопировать в образ
Vladimir
Ну или волюмами сделать так чтобы maven увидел в контейнере уже готовые зависимости и их взял для сборки
Vladimir
Я чекал в инете, что для этого нужно делать кеширование слоев с зависимостями
A
Короче мне нужно папку тупо скопировать в образ
Ну тупо и пишите COPY .m2/repo куда вы хотите в образ. Ну и учтите что dockerfile при этом должен лежать в admin
Vladimir
Да походу так
Vladimir
А вы как работаете с зависимостями?
A
А вы как работаете с зависимостями?
По-разному. Вам бы с базой разобраться
Vladimir
Базой?
Vladimir
Базой данных?
A
Базой знаний
Aleksey
Базой данных?
Ну что получилось?
Aleksey
Базой данных?
P. S винда норм тема
Vladimir
Ну что получилось?
Короче, я решил сборку делать до создания контейнера
Vladimir
А в контейнер отправляь собраный жарник
Vladimir
И там запускать
Aleksey
Короче, я решил сборку делать до создания контейнера
Ну так тоже можно, по умному это чот типа с артефактами
Vladimir
Да, типа того)
Aleksey
Короче, я решил сборку делать до создания контейнера
А когда ты и первый композ скидывал у тебя совсем не правильно вольмы были
Vladimir
Компоуз ? Докеркомпоуз? Я кидал только докерфайл
Aleksey
Т9
Vladimir
Там где Copy ?
Aleksey
Угу
Vladimir
Блин походу я слепой и не вижу
Vladimir
Мне / - надо убрать с начала?
Vladimir
Путь вродебы правильный
Aleksey
Мне / - надо убрать с начала?
Ну это тоже, путь у тебя 'с,' маленькая и далее
Vladimir
А должна быть большая
Vladimir
Ок
Aleksey
А должна быть большая
На сколько я помню винде она да заглавная
Vladimir
Понял спасибо большое
Aleksey
А должна быть большая
Ты проще сделай
Aleksey
В главной деректории диска С или Д создай проект
Aleksey
По типу ты линуксойд
Aleksey
Там у тебя миним четыре файла
Aleksey
App твой хело ворд ,докер и докеркомоз + . ENV
Vladimir
Ок, я уже сделал еще проще, но нужно будет как нибудь попробовать твой вариант
Aleksey
Понял спасибо большое
Ещё лайф хак если пользуешься IDA то она сама может делать докер файлы
Vladimir
Когда из эклипса перейду, тогда попробую эту функцию
Vladimir
Базой знаний
к слову а что в входит в так называемую "базу"?
A
к слову а что в входит в так называемую "базу"?
Никаких секретов - https://docs.docker.com
A
Если чо пиши
Да вы уже в лс думаю там можете
Vladimir
понял, спасибо большое
Aleksey
Тут чаще вопросы задаю разрабы по моему мнению
A
Да нет
@SVlad1422 пишите ему в лс
Aleksey
В личку не пишу только если по просят
A
В личку не пишу только если по просят
Вы уже там как-то договоритесь. Он сам походу напишет. Не в чат
Дмитрий Ким 👨‍💻
Не, лучшая ОС для десктопа
Вот они, повылезали
Дмитрий Ким 👨‍💻
Если таких слушать, окажется что вообще лучше без OS сидеть, в биосе ковыряться
Владимир
Если таких слушать, окажется что не существовало никакой UEFI более 20 лет
Alexander 🌨
Всем привет. Кто-нибудь знает, возможно ли указать ссылку на github Dockerfile, будет работать? У разработчика, как я понял обновляется только dockerfile на github, на docker hub он видимо положил. container_name: app1 image: app build: context: . dockerfile: ./Dockerfile
Alexander 🌨
Не будет.
понял, спасибо.
Алексей
Коллеги, приветствую. Есть довольно банальная задача, но так как я с докером на вы, то что-то заклинило и не выходит. У нас есть несколько локальных сервисов которые внутри сети и не проброшены в мир. Для них через certbot certonly --manual -d xxx.ru получаем letsencrypt сертификат ( через текстовую запись которую предоставляет сертбот). Зачем? Ну просто внутри сети чтобы не ругались браузеры и было красиво, через certbot renew получаем обновления таких сертификатов и спим спокойно.Недавно развернули в докере wiki.js, оно так же лкоально торчит на, грубо говоря 10.12.1.105:80. Мне нужно так же сделать локальный ssl внутри сети для этого сайта( wiki.xxx.ru) но не пойму как. Я пробовал traefik и тд, все просто если мы пробрасываем в мир ресурс, но мне же надо другое ( см. выше)
Алексей
nginx proxy manager тоже умеет как будто в acme challenge но только из списка dns провайдеров из плагина для сертбота, а просто txt не может
A
Коллеги, приветствую. Есть довольно банальная задача, но так как я с докером на вы, то что-то заклинило и не выходит. У нас есть несколько локальных сервисов которые внутри сети и не проброшены в мир. Для них через certbot certonly --manual -d xxx.ru получаем letsencrypt сертификат ( через текстовую запись которую предоставляет сертбот). Зачем? Ну просто внутри сети чтобы не ругались браузеры и было красиво, через certbot renew получаем обновления таких сертификатов и спим спокойно.Недавно развернули в докере wiki.js, оно так же лкоально торчит на, грубо говоря 10.12.1.105:80. Мне нужно так же сделать локальный ssl внутри сети для этого сайта( wiki.xxx.ru) но не пойму как. Я пробовал traefik и тд, все просто если мы пробрасываем в мир ресурс, но мне же надо другое ( см. выше)
Вы можете подтверждать необязательно txt записью. Можно в dns. Вопрос не поо прокси и доцкер в целом
Алексей
ну я понимаю что я могу просто поставить nginx не в докере и редиректить на порт контейнера
Алексей
но что-то не выходит) Может быть есть пример или информация для изучения
Алексей
вопрос скорее к знатокам про методологию "как правильно"
Алексей
или как принято)
A
Прям по феншую нет. Можете как создавать как файлик на веб сервере, так и запись в днс. По практике - файлик быстрее обрабатывается.
Алексей
сам сервер от инета не отрезан, сертбот может ходить во внешку.Цель получить ssl для локального сервиса без проброса в мир через A-запись
Алексей
т.е. есть запись в локальном dns для wiki.xxx.ru там, куда делегировано dns могу создать txt запись для сертбота ( dns challenge или как-то так)
Алексей
правилами на шлюзе закрыт доступ на сервер извне, наверное так чуть понятнее будет
A
У вас вопросы не по докеру какбэ